RE-EDITED:

You need to have a cIOS rev12 or higher to use Startpatch v4.1. My problem was that I was using cIOS11 and cIOS10 on my second wii. Both are based on IOS36 and are not compatible with the latest Startpatch. So, if you want to go to system menu 4.1 and use startpatch 4.1, you *must* use cIOSrev12 or higher (13a, 13b)

EDIT:

AHA! I found the problem! Forget the above steps I posted. Only one thing is needed is to install a cIOS rev12 or HIGHER. This should be added to the readme.

The reason I got the -1017 error previously was because I was running cIOS11 (which is based off of IOS36). I tried on another wii I have here with cIOS rev10 (also based off of IOS36) and got the same error. After installing cIOS13a, the error disappeared. This is becuase cIOS13a (and 12, 13b) are based off of IOS38.
